Communication Analysts:

      • Review calls from correctional agencies and meet targeted call minute requirements with the ability to recognize key words, phrases, cryptic messages, slang/gang terms and other hidden messages and disseminate
      • Examine and analyze a variety of call recordings and escalate intelligence regarding victims, and persons suspected of violating statutes, policies and/or procedures, or program requirements administered by the assigned agency.
      • Listens to or reads through material in one language, ascertains understanding of the meaning and context of that material, and converts it into a second language, making sure to preserve the original meaning
      • Examine and analyze a variety of call recordings and respective intelligence regarding improper or unlawful activities including but not limited to: resulting in the diversion of controlled drugs, assault or any other bodily harm (physical or sexual), weapons location, cell phone location, escape, and suicide
      • Proofread translated material for grammar, spelling and punctuation accuracy and return it in the required format

Security Professionals:

      • Creating and implementing a strategy for the deployment of information security technologies
      • Performing IT security risk assessments and reporting on ways to minimize threats
      • Monitoring security vulnerabilities and hacking threats in network and host systems
      • Tracking latest IT security innovations and keeping abreast of latest cyber security technologies
      • Ensuring business continuity
      • Communicating with key stakeholders about IT security threats
      • Implementing an effective process for the reporting of security incidents
      • Overseeing the investigation of reported security breaches
      • Developing strategies to handle security incidents and trigger investigations
      • Managing the IT security team, security experts and advisors
      • Complying with the latest regulations and compliance requirements
      • Championing and educating the organization about the latest security strategies and technologies
